HARWELL, Justice:

Appellant Dorchester County Water Authority (the Authority) appeals from the trial court's refusal to issue an injunction or declaratory judgment against respondent Dorchester County Council. We reverse.

This dispute involves the proposed takeover by Dorchester County of a special purpose district located within its boundaries after the home rule amendments to the South Carolina Constitution, Article VIII.
